Le Panthéon, sanctuaire des grands personnages de la République

Le Panthéon est un monument de style néo-classique situé dans le 5ᵉ arrondissement de Paris, au cœur du Quartier latin, sur la montagne Sainte-Geneviève.
Il est considéré comme le temple de la nation française.
En créant une architecture religieuse exemplaire, Soufflot répondait au vœu de Louis XV de glorifier dignement la monarchie en la personne de sainte Geneviève.
On y trouve aujourd'hui les dépouilles des grandes femmes et des grands hommes qui ont marqué l'Histoire de la France.

Did you know? You can watch the Earth rotate thanks to Foucault's pendulum in Paris.

Want to see the Earth spinning at the end of a wire? You're in luck, because two of Foucault's pendulums can be seen in Paris, in the heart of the Panthéon and the Musée des Arts et Métiers.
